The 2024 Ontario Sunshine List shows that the average and median salaries for a Instrumentation Technician are $124,898.32 and $114,194.46, respectively.
In 2024, Yingguo Sun, holding the position of Electrical, Instrumentation And Control Technician at the Atura received the highest salary of $221,862.95 among similar positions in Ontario public organizations. Samik Doshi, serving as the Instrumentation Technician at City of Hamilton , earned the highest salary of $158,707.59 among individuals in the same position across public organizations in Ontario during that year.
In the year 2024, the highest-paying organizations for Instrumentation Technician and similar positions in the Ontario were as follows: Atura with an average pay of $177,168.09; City of Hamilton with an average pay of $144,262.88; The Ottawa Hospital with an average pay of $126,485.87; Ontario Clean Water Agency with an average pay of $116,367.19; and City of Toronto with an average pay of $112,912.54.
A total of 10 organizations had employees who held comparable positions as mentioned in the Ontario Sunshine list.
In the year 2024, the highest-paying sector or industries for Instrumentation Technician and similar positions in the Ontario were as follows: Ontario Power Generation with an average pay of $177,168.09; Hospitals and Boards of Public Health with an average pay of $126,485.87; and Crown Agencies with an average pay of $116,367.19.
There were 5 sectors where employees held similar positions, as indicated in the Ontario Sunshine list.
The 2024 Ontario Sunshine List indicates that the representation of gender diversity in Instrumentation Technician is 84.13% male and 15.87% female, respectively.
